The learning stage that involves analyzing lessons learned is reflection. This stage is vital because it allows individuals to process their experiences, evaluate outcomes, and identify insights that can inform future actions and decisions. Reflection encourages critical thinking, helping learners take the time to consider what worked well, what didn't, and how they can apply knowledge in similar situations moving forward.

In educational frameworks, reflection is often seen as a key component of experiential learning, where learners engage with their experiences critically. This process not only reinforces knowledge but also fosters personal and professional growth. By systematically reflecting on lessons learned, individuals develop a deeper understanding of the material and improve their capacity to apply it effectively in various contexts.
